"ALL KICKS, BUT NO PRAISE.

A defence of the work of the Health Department was put up by the Minister of Health (the Hon. bir Maui Pomare) in the House of Representatives yesterday afternoon.

"I want lion, members to recognise the good and efficient work of tho Health Department,'' doolarcd tho Minister. "Thero are not many who recognise it. Tho Department gets nil the kicks, but no praise."
